Nordic cruising

packed with panoramas

High-altitude cross-country trails with a total length of 12 kilometres are located in the Obergurgl-Hochgurgl region. Thanks to the altitude of 1,930 metres, the best conditions for trying out cross-country skis can be found here from December until late spring.

Easy

sunny trail

Sport at an altitude of about 2,000 metres is not only blessed with lots of snow but is also extremely beneficial to your health. So that beginners get their money's worth too, there is a two-kilometre-long practice track in Obergurgl for all beginners.

Extended

cross-country skiing fun

On the Pill-Angern-Poschach high-altitude cross-country trail you can enjoy stunning nature over seven kilometres. Starting at the Hochgurgl gondola bottom station, the route runs in a slight and moderate ascent to the Königsrain and Alt-Poschach parts of town before the cross-country ski run takes you along the Gurgler Ache back to your starting point.

Cross-country skiing courses

in the region

It is well known that practice makes perfect and with a little help and good technique you will reach your goal faster. During the cross-country skiing courses in Obergurgl and Hochgurgl you will learn how to use the poles correctly, the easy movements and other basics you need for your first day on the trail.
